The Town of Blacksburg continues the 2014 Market Square Jam series with host Ogle Eddie and Friends on Wednesday, September 3rd.
Ogle Eddie of Roanoke, VA is a terrific story teller, folk song musician and singer will share history through music and song.
Market Square Jam is a weekly jam session that takes place in the warmer months on Wednesday evenings from 8-11 pm at the site of the Farmers Market on the corner of Draper Road and Roanoke Street.
The Jam, catering to traditional old time and bluegrass music, brings musicians together to pick a tune, enjoy some fun times with their friends and family, and take in all that downtown Blacksburg has to offer.
